The ICBC CNI New Energy Vehicle Battery ETF is strategically tailored to enable investments within the burgeoning sector of new energy vehicle batteries. By tracking the performance of companies at the forefront of this industry, this ETF serves as a conduit for investors aiming to engage with the green transition, particularly in the automotive sector. It leverages the growing demand and technological advancements in battery technology, essential for electric vehicles, underpinning the transition towards sustainable transportation methods. This exchange-traded fund mirrors the broader industry trends focusing on decarbonization and the innovation of sustainable energy sources, positioning itself as a critical instrument in the financial market for forward-thinking investors.
This ETF provides investors with a unique opportunity to invest in companies leading the charge in battery technology for new energy vehicles. It encompasses firms specializing in the manufacture of battery cells, including those working on next-generation battery technologies that promise greater efficiency and longevity for electric vehicles.
Understanding the significance of raw materials like lithium and cobalt in the battery production process, the ETF also includes investments in companies engaged in the extraction and processing of these critical materials. This aspect of the ETF caters to the growing need for high-quality materials essential for battery performance and longevity.
Acknowledging the importance of sustainability in the battery lifecycle, the ETF also involves companies that are pioneering in the field of battery recycling. These firms contribute to the circular economy by enabling the reuse of battery components, which is crucial for reducing waste and the environmental impact of used batteries. Moreover, the ETF invests in entities that are leading innovation within the battery sector, targeting advancements that can lead to more sustainable and efficient energy storage solutions.
